Development of JOYO MK-II core characteristics database

  • 1. Experimental Reactor Division, Japan Nuclear Cycle Development Inst., Oarai, Ibaraki (Japan)

Description

The experimental fast reactor JOYO served as the MK-II irradiation bed core for testing fuel and material for FBR development for 15 years from 1982 to 1997. During the MK-II operation, extensive data were accumulated from the core characteristics tests conducted in thirty-one duty operations and thirteen special test operations. These core management data and core characteristics data were compiled into a database. The core management data include specifications and configurations of the core, atomic number density before and after irradiation, neutron flux, neutron fluence, fuel burn-up, and temperature and power distributions. Core characteristics data include excess reactivities, control rod worths, and reactivity coefficients,e.g., temperature, power and burn-up. These data were recorded on CD-ROM for user convenience.
